| Word | Word Type | Definition |
|---|---|---|
| Inward | a. | Being or placed within; inner; interior; -- opposed to outward. |
| Inward | a. | Seated in the mind, heart, spirit, or soul. |
| Inward | a. | Intimate; domestic; private. |
| Inward | n. | That which is inward or within; especially, in the plural, the inner parts or organs of the body; the viscera. |
| Inward | n. | The mental faculties; -- usually pl. |
| Inward | n. | An intimate or familiar friend or acquaintance. |
| Inward | a. | Alt. of Inwards |
